About this episode

Today’s class will not be based on a conversation as usual, but instead will be an intensive lecture on the [요 form] from the beginning to the end.


🔷Homework

1. Using [요 form] and write about your hobby. 


Ex ) 저는 한국요리 자주 만들어요.

        I often cook Korean food.
